The Dynamics of a Cabinet Reshuffle

So, what exactly goes into a cabinet reshuffle, and why does it even happen? Guys, think of it like a major team strategy meeting for the country. The President, in this case, Prabowo Subianto, makes these changes to improve the team's performance, address emerging issues, or sometimes, just to inject fresh energy and perspectives. It could be that certain ministers aren't performing as expected, or perhaps new challenges have arisen that require a different skill set or a change in approach. Sometimes, it's about rewarding loyalty or balancing different political factions within the ruling coalition. Reshuffling the cabinet is a powerful tool for a president to assert their authority, realign their administration with their vision, and ensure that the government machinery is running smoothly and efficiently. It's not a decision taken lightly, as it involves selecting individuals who are not only competent but also politically astute and capable of handling the immense pressure that comes with public office. The process often involves extensive consultations, careful consideration of candidates' track records, and a deep understanding of the political currents. Ultimately, the goal is to create a more cohesive, effective, and responsive government that can better serve the people and achieve the administration's policy objectives. It’s a crucial moment that can either strengthen the government's mandate or, if mishandled, lead to instability and public criticism.
